Building Decks for Queen Anne's Position Above the Sound

Queen Anne sits on one of Seattle's steepest hills, and a lot of its homes look out over Puget Sound, the Ship Canal, or downtown. That elevation and exposure is part of what makes the neighborhood desirable — and part of what makes deck-building here different from a flat lot elsewhere in King County. Homes on the west and south-facing slopes catch salt-laden air moving in off the Sound, while lots shaded by mature Douglas fir and maple canopy stay damp for months at a stretch. A deck built without those specifics in mind can look fine for a year or two and then start showing problems: soft spots near the house, black streaking on the boards, fasteners bleeding rust through the finish.

What Queen Anne's Climate Does to an Ordinary Deck

Three things separate a Queen Anne build site from a more sheltered, inland King County lot:

  • Salt air. Proximity to Puget Sound accelerates corrosion on unprotected fasteners, connectors, and any exposed metal hardware, especially on decks with an open western or southern exposure.
  • Driving rain. Hillside lots catch wind-driven rain at angles a flat site rarely sees, pushing moisture into joints, ledger connections, and end grain that a more sheltered deck wouldn't have to deal with.
  • A long moss season. Between the tree canopy common in older Queen Anne yards and roughly seven to eight months of wet weather each year, shaded decking surfaces stay damp long enough for moss and algae to take hold, which makes boards slick and eventually holds moisture against the wood.

None of this means a deck can't hold up here for decades. It means the details that get skipped on a rush job are exactly the details that matter most in this location.

The Details That Determine How Long a Deck Lasts

Ledger Board Flashing

The ledger board — where the deck attaches to the house — is the single most common point of failure we see on decks that were built without proper flashing. Water that gets behind an unflashed or poorly flashed ledger doesn't dry out quickly in this climate; it sits against the house's structural framing and rim joist, and over years that leads to rot that's expensive to repair because it's hidden behind decking and siding. We flash every ledger connection with a code-compliant water-resistive detail and metal flashing, not caulk alone.

Fasteners and Hardware

Given the salt air moving through this part of the county, we use fasteners and structural connectors chosen for corrosion resistance — hot-dip galvanized or stainless steel, matched to the framing and decking material. Mixing incompatible metals or using interior-grade fasteners on an exposed hillside deck is a common shortcut that shows up as rust streaks and weakened connections within a few seasons.

Drainage and Airflow Underneath

Decks built low to the ground or over a patio need a real plan for water to get out from underneath — proper board spacing, correct ground grading, and in some cases a drainage system for usable space below. Without it, the underside of the deck stays wet through the winter and becomes the spot where moss, mildew, and eventually rot take hold first.

Signs an Existing Deck Needs Repair or Replacement

If you already have a deck on your Queen Anne property, it's worth knowing what to look for before a small problem becomes a structural one. On an inspection, we look for:

  • Soft or spongy decking, especially near the ledger board or in shaded corners that stay damp
  • Rust staining bleeding out from screws, nails, or joist hangers
  • Persistent moss or dark algae that comes back within weeks of cleaning
  • Railings or stair stringers that have started to wobble or separate from their posts
  • Gaps opening up at the ledger flashing or house connection

Caught early, a lot of these issues are repairable — replacing a section of decking, re-flashing a ledger, swapping out corroded hardware. Left through another wet season, they tend to spread into the framing, at which point a full rebuild is usually the more honest recommendation than patching around rot that's already traveled.

Choosing the Right Decking Material for This Site

There isn't one right decking material for every Queen Anne lot — it depends on sun exposure, shade, budget, and how much upkeep you want to take on. Here's how the common options actually compare in this climate:

MaterialHow It Handles This ClimateMaintenance
Pressure-treated woodAffordable and strong, but needs quality sealant reapplied regularly or it will gray, check, and hold moss in shaded spotsHigher — annual cleaning and periodic re-sealing
CedarNaturally rot- and insect-resistant with a warmer look, but softer than composite and still needs finish upkeep in a wet, shaded yardModerate to higher
Composite deckingResists moisture absorption and won't splinter or rot, though algae can still grow on the surface in deep shade if it's never cleanedLower — periodic washing
PVC deckingFully synthetic and the most resistant to moisture and staining; often the best fit for heavily shaded or low-airflow spotsLowest

Designing and Permitting for Hillside Lots in Seattle

Structural Design on a Slope

A lot of Queen Anne properties aren't flat, and that changes how a deck gets engineered. Multi-level decks, taller support posts, and stairs down a grade all need footings sized and placed for the actual soil and slope, not a standard flat-lot layout. On a steep or view-oriented lot, getting the structural design right the first time matters more than it does on a simple ground-level deck. We design around your site's actual grade rather than a stock plan, and size the structure for the loads a hillside deck really carries.

Seattle Permits and Code

Most new decks and significant deck replacements in Seattle require a building permit, and the requirements can shift depending on height, size, and proximity to a property line — which matters on Queen Anne's tighter, sloped lots. Guardrail height, baluster spacing, and footing depth are all governed by code, and an inspector will check them. What to Ask Before Hiring a Deck Contractor in Queen Anne

Not every contractor who builds decks in King County has dealt with hillside footings, ledger flashing on an older Queen Anne home, or the moss and algae issues that show up on shaded lots near the water. Before you hire anyone, it's worth asking:

  • Will you pull the required Seattle permit, or is that left to me?
  • How will the ledger board be flashed, and what happens if the existing rim joist has moisture damage?
  • What grade of fastener and hardware do you use, and is it suited to salt-air exposure?
  • How is footing depth and structural design adjusted for a sloped lot?
  • What's the realistic maintenance schedule for the decking material you're recommending, given the shade and moisture at my specific site?

A contractor who's worked Queen Anne before should be able to answer all of these without hesitating, because they've run into the same site conditions elsewhere in the neighborhood. How do I verify a deck contractor is properly licensed and insured in Washington?

Ask for their Washington state contractor license number, which you can look up directly through the L&I website, and confirm they carry general liability insurance. A licensed, insured contractor should also pull permits in their own name rather than asking you to file as an owner-builder. Hesitation on either point is worth treating as a red flag.

What's the real difference between composite and PVC decking, and does it matter for a Queen Anne lot?

Composite decking is a wood-plastic blend that resists rot and splintering but still contains some organic material, while PVC decking is fully synthetic and handles constant moisture and shade with the least upkeep. For a heavily shaded, damp lot, PVC often makes more sense; for a sunnier spot, composite is a good, more affordable middle ground. Either is a step up from bare wood if you want to minimize yearly maintenance.

Is stainless steel or hot-dip galvanized hardware better for a deck this close to Puget Sound?

Both resist corrosion well, but they suit different parts of the structure. We typically use stainless steel for fasteners in direct, ongoing contact with moisture since it holds up better long-term in salt-influenced air, and hot-dip galvanized hardware for more protected framing connections. Mixing incompatible metals in the same connection is what actually causes premature corrosion, so consistency matters as much as the grade itself.

Do decks in Queen Anne need to be built any differently than decks elsewhere in King County?

The core building code is the same countywide, but Queen Anne's hillside lots often call for deeper or engineered footings, more attention to ledger flashing on older homes, and material choices suited to shaded, damp yards near the Sound. A flat, drier lot elsewhere in the county can sometimes get by with a simpler build. We adjust the design to the specific site rather than using one standard plan everywhere.
